WebJul 3, 2024 · In grammar, a quantifie r is a type of determiner (such as all, some, or much) that expresses a relative or indefinite indication of quantity. Quantifiers usually appear in front of nouns (as in all children ), but they may also function as pronouns (as in All have returned ). WebFeb 19, 2024 · In English grammar, a noun is a part of speech (or word class) that names or identifies a person, place, thing, quality, idea, or activity. Most nouns have both a singular and plural form, can be preceded by an article and/or one or more adjectives, and can serve as the head of a noun phrase. The Rule. From the definitions of mass and count given above you may have already guessed the rule for pluralizing … fibercement fiyatWebSome nouns can be both count and noncount. When they change from a count to a noncount noun, the meaning changes slightly. In the noncount form, the noun refers to the whole idea or quantity. In the count form, the noun refers to a specific example or type.
